733.202 Petition.Any interested person may petition for administration.
History.s. 1, ch. 74-106; s. 52, ch. 75-220; s. 19, ch. 77-87; s. 19, ch. 92-200; s. 986, ch. 97-102; s. 86, ch. 2001-226.
Note.Created from former s. 732.43.
